Output deb16f9f83c601ff8b9687da1c314bf04b8a00aac1a51f662ead8e962e0f77bd:2

value
78907914
script pubkey
OP_0 OP_PUSHBYTES_20 6c3cd52b02e5845436d8da8aeff68bdc37f804e5
address
bc1qds7d22czukz9gdkcm29wla5tmsmlsp89pxtz58
transaction
deb16f9f83c601ff8b9687da1c314bf04b8a00aac1a51f662ead8e962e0f77bd
confirmations
18732
spent
true